William Frederick Smith 1958

William Frederick Smith Jr of Bexar County, TX, died on June 8, 1958 in Stoddard County, MO, and was buried at San Francisco National Cemetery Section NAWS Site 1036-B Lincoln Blvd - Presidio Of San Francisco, in San Francisco, Ca. Did you know?
In 1833, on August 12th, Chicago was incorporated as a town at the estuary of the Chicago River by 350 settlers. Chicago’s first permanent resident was a trader named Jean Baptiste Point du Sable, a free black man -perhaps from Haiti - who went there in the late 1770s. At first, it was simply a trading post but it grew quickly, going from trading post to town to city in 1837.
Did you know?
In 1850, on April 4th, the city of Los Angeles - now the 2nd most populous city in the US - was incorporated. On April 15th, the city of San Francisco - now the 15h most populous city in the US - was incorporated. Both cities were incorporated before California became a state.
